This guide will provide valuable insight into the complexities of ancillary probate and explain how to navigate the process to minimize potential hassles for your loved ones.<\/p>\n<h4>Section 1: Grasping the Concept of Ancillary Probate<\/h4>\n<p>When a person owns real estate in more than one state and passes away, their estate must go through the probate process in each of those states. The initial probate proceeding occurs in the state where the deceased individual resided, referred to as &#8220;<a href=\"https:\/\/www.nycprobate.com\/probate-blog\/estate-domicile-vs-residence\/\">domiciliary probate.<\/a>&#8221; Subsequent probate proceedings in other states, known as &#8220;ancillary probate,&#8221; then follow.<\/p>\n<h4>Section 2: How Ancillary Probate Works<\/h4>\n<p>The executor of the estate initiates the ancillary probate process by opening a probate case in the additional state where the decedent owned real estate. This process may require hiring an attorney licensed in that state, especially if the executor resides elsewhere. Executors must provide the necessary documents to the probate court, such as the will, death certificate, and an authenticated copy of the domiciliary probate proceedings. The court then reviews and approves the documents, allowing the executor to distribute the assets in accordance with the deceased&#8217;s will or state law.<\/p>\n<h4>Section 3: The Consequences of Ancillary Probate<\/h4>\n<p>Ancillary probate often leads to increased expenses, time, and complications for the deceased&#8217;s loved ones. These consequences include: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Additional attorney and court fees<\/li>\n<li>Extended probate process duration<\/li>\n<li>Increased likelihood of disputes among heirs<\/li>\n<li>Complications due to differences in state laws<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h4>Section 4: Strategies for Avoiding Ancillary Probate<\/h4>\n<p>It is possible to avoid the ancillary probate process with careful estate planning. Implementing one or more of the following strategies can help:<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ff6600;\"><strong>Establish a revocable living trust<\/strong><\/span>: By transferring the title of the out-of-state property to the trust, the assets will no longer need to go through probate.<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ff6600;\"><strong>Utilize joint ownership<\/strong><\/span>: Adding a co-owner to the property, such as a spouse, allows the surviving owner to inherit the property without going through probate.<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ff6600;\"><strong>Create a transfer-on-death deed<\/strong><\/span>: Some states allow for this type of deed, which transfers the property to the designated beneficiary upon the owner&#8217;s death, bypassing probate.<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ff6600;\"><strong>Consult with an experienced estate planning attorney<\/strong><\/span>: This professional can provide guidance on the best methods to avoid ancillary probate based on individual circumstances.<\/p>\n<h4>Conclusion: Protect Your Loved Ones Through Proactive Estate Planning<\/h4>\n<p>Ancillary probate can pose significant challenges for your loved ones after your passing. By understanding the process and implementing strategies to avoid it, you can ensure a smoother and less stressful experience for those who inherit your property.
